For Your Toddler

Toddlerhood is such a fun and interesting time for both parents and children. Toddlers assert their independence, which doesn't always make things easy for the parents, especially at meal times.

Free Will

Asserting their preferences, likes and dislikes is part of growing up for toddlers, and can it ever come out at meal times! Unfortunately, the harder you push, the more your toddler may dig their heels in and create a scenario that is really quite trying. Support for Little Bodies

Toddlerhood can be a time when children have constant colds, coughs, earaches or some other bug and their little immune systems are constantly struggling. Being around other children and their germs doesn't help, but is unavoidable.

Boosting your toddler's immune system can help them fight off what comes their way and support their systems to beat what they do get, faster.
